Vayots Dzor Areni Wine Route (Private Tour)
Just two hours south of Yerevan, Vayots Dzor is home to wineries and vineyards. Here, the thirsty traveler can tour a winery to learn about Armenia’s unbroken tradition of winemaking while sampling vintages from across the ages.
At the heart of the Vayots Dzor Wine Route is the Areni-1 Cave, site of the oldest known winery in the world. Armenian wines have been gracing Armenian tables for at least 6000 years. Today, this wine culture is kept alive by a handful of enthusiastic winemakers who continue to cultivate ancient varietals. Spend a day exploring one of Vayots Dzor’s winemaking facilities, taking a tour of the production process, and tasting local wines.
Along the Vayots Dzor Wine Route, there are few wineries that offer regular tours and tastings: Momik Winery, Old Bridge Winery.

Sevanavank Monastery, Haghartsin Monastery, Dilijan National Park
During this private tour you will visit Lake Sevan, the pearl of our mountainous country and one of the largest freshwater high-altitude lakes in Eurasia. See Sevanavank monastic complex, located on the peninsula, overlooking the whole beauty of the lake. Currently a religious seminary functions here which is not readily open to the public. Afterwards the route heads to Dilijan, also called "Armenian Switzerland" for its fantastic natural forests. The city is part of the Dilijan National Park. You will stop at the 10th century Haghartsin monastery, which has been recently renovated by donation of Sheikh Dr. Sultan Bin Mohammad Al Qassimi, the Ruler of Sharjah, who was impressed by the monastery when visiting it.

Haghpat Monastery, Sanahin Monastery Akhtala Day Tour in Armenia
The nature and sights of the Lori region always attract numerous tourists. Today we will get acquainted with some of the beautiful sights of Lori. The first shortstop will be at the «Gntunik» food court in Aparan, where we can have breakfast or do some necessary shopping.
During the tour, we will visit Haghpat and Sanahin Monasteries, Mendz Er cave, the famous Sanahin ancient bridge, Alaverdi town, Surb Astvatsatsin Monastery in Akhtala, Akhtala fortress and Aramyants castle. Haghpat Monastery, one of the largest monastic complexes in Armenia, is located 6 km away from the Sanahin Monastery in Haghpat village. The Akhtala fortress is supposed to have been founded in the 10th century by the Bagratuni-Kyurikyans princely family ruling this area until the end of the 12th century.
The last stop of the tour is the castle of Maecenas Aramyants. It was built in the Swiss style. The Declaration on the establishment of the First Republic of Armenia was adopted here. Total distance is 400 km
One day trip to three southern regions of Armenia
Full-day trip to three southern regions of Armenia: Ararat, Vayots Dzor and Syunik. The first stop will be at Khor Virap Monastery in Ararat Valley. Here the Christian history of Armenia commenced in early 4-th century. Except the monastery you will also visit the underground dungeon, where St Gregory the Illuminator was kept for 13 years. The vista point here has one of the best views to mount Ararat. You will continue the way to the picturesque Gnishik canyon and reach Noravank Monastery surrounded by red rocks. Wine Region Car Tour in Yerevan
We set off to the highest mountain in Armenia – Aragats. Along the way, we will be accompanied by breathtaking landscapes.
We will make a stop at the Amberd Fortress at an altitude of 2300 meters. You will see stone structures, including a 7th-century castle and an 11th-century church. As you stroll around, you will appreciate not only the ancient architecture but also the surrounding mountain expanses.
Next, we arrive at the southern slope of Aragats, at the Byurakan Observatory. You will visit the interior and be able to view stars, planets, and other celestial bodies through powerful telescopes. Our astronomer guides will answer all your questions.
